USB: cypress_m8: switch to generic TIOCMIWAIT implementation
Switch to the generic TIOCMIWAIT implementation which does not suffer from the races involved when using the deprecated sleep_on functions. Acked-by: Arnd Bergmann <arnd@arndb.de> Signed-off-by: Johan Hovold <jhovold@gmail.com> Signed-off-by: Greg Kroah-Hartman <gregkh@linuxfoundation.org>
